Visual Study Techniques
Although many students understand intricate chemistry principles through conventional approaches, imagery-based instruction can substantially improve understanding for those who excel with imagery and spatial awareness. Tutors can include diagrams, structural models, and graphs to demonstrate chemical processes and formations, making theoretical concepts more tangible. Utilizing color-coded notes and interactive simulations can also engage visual learners, helping them to picture mechanisms like bonding or reaction mechanisms. Additionally, integrating visual recordings that demonstrate laboratory work or real-world uses of chemistry can offer perspective and enhance retention. By modifying their strategies to include these imagery components, tutors can establish a more inclusive learning environment, addressing diverse learning styles and ultimately promoting a deeper comprehension of chemistry concepts among their students.

Kinesthetic Study Methods
For bodily-kinesthetic learners, hands-on experiences and movement-based tasks are essential in grasping complex principles in chemistry. Expert chemistry tutors can elevate learning by incorporating interactive experiments and tactile materials. Utilizing models, such as molecular kits, helps students to visualize configurations and reactions physically. Additionally, engaging students in lab activities cultivates a deeper understanding of scientific principles through real-world applications. Tutors may also use role-playing scenarios, where students enact chemical processes, reinforcing knowledge through movement. Furthermore, integrating technology, such as virtual labs, provides immersive experiences for those unable to conduct experiments in person. By customizing strategies to align with kinesthetic preferences, tutors can greatly boost student attention and insight in chemistry.

What Is the Standard Cost of Chemistry Tutoring Sessions?
Chemistry tutoring sessions generally cost between $30 to $100 per hour, determined by elements like the tutor's experience, location, and session length. Rates can vary significantly dependent on specific situations and specific needs.
